Agency on Aging Advisory Council

  • One unexpired term through December 31, 2025
  • Two upcoming terms starting January 1, 2024 through December 31, 2026

The AOA Advisory Council is a non-governing board which furthers the Agency on Aging’s efforts to develop and coordinate community-based systems of services for older persons in Flathead County, including advising the agency relative to the interests of older persons, and participating in the development and implementation of the Area Plan on Aging.

Flathead Emergency Communications Center Operations Board

  • One upcoming term for a Columbia Falls Police Dept. Representative starting January 1, 2024 through December 31, 2025

The Operations Board assists the FECC in oversight of equipment usage, system design, programming, operating procedures, circuits, telecommunications terminals for criminal history record information. They also provide advice for call-taking and dispatch policies and procedures, quality improvement monitoring and review, new equipment proposals, etc.

Transportation Advisory Committee

  • Two upcoming terms starting January 1, 2024 through December 31, 2026

The Transportation Advisory Committee assists the Agency on Aging in cooperatively assessing and prioritizing local transportation needs and identifying opportunities for community collaboration and coordination to help the Agency achieve more cost-effective service delivery, increase capacity to serve unmet needs, improve quality of service, and ensure services are easily understood and accessed by riders.
